The answer is to not just choose to 'print the page' when you're in Gmail.
Firstly, make sure that your GMail and Google Chrome software versions are up to date.
You then have two options. In the top right hand corner of your GMail, if you select the drop down menu to the right of the 'Reply' button, you'll find a print option there. THAT print option prints just the current conversation / email - not all the other associated messages. (See pic below)
If you want to print the entire conversation (all associated messages) choose the printer icon just above the Reply button.
Printing from within Google Chrome nowadays is really easy. You automatically get a print preview page, a choice of where to print to and which pages to print. And you can easily see how many pages are going to be produced.
